Abstract

Ice accretion has adverse effects on outdoor equipment, and slippery liquid-infused surface has attracted increasing attention due to its low ice adhesion strength (τice) and great potential in practical application. However, the surface lubricant loss leads to the failure of icephobicity in this system. In this paper, the icephobic surface with external and self-replenishing properties (RDLS) is prepared to enhance anti-icing and deicing properties by the facile method with infusing the silicone oil and fumed silica into the epoxy resin adhesive. As an outcome, the prepared RDLS exhibit anti-icing and deicing properties, and it also shows mechanical durability. Meanwhile, the use of fumed silica is proposed to act as a reservoir for silicone oil to extend the lifetime of oil-releasing properties. The icephobicity of the coating can also be improved by the proper amount of fumed silica. Furthermore, obtained RDLS showed superior sustainability, and the silicone oil in the coating can be replenished easily. The problem of icephobic failure caused by lubricant loss is solved effectively. This work provides a new and facile way to fabricate an icephobic coating with external and self-replenishing properties.
